Sidewinder has been there for a long time! I remember seeing it way back n 90 or 92. Back then, they had the Trabant sitting near Sidewinder. Plus a Huss Rainbow called Conestoga dressed up as a covered wagon but they still kept the sun face n the middle.

+Deathbyillusion Just wondering but when the ride goes upside down, does it feel like your gonna fall off of the cart or do you stay well put on the seat? If so does it feels like that on any other rides that go upside down?
It varies on different elements. On this you're being squashed down on your seat but let's say on Great Bear the heart line roll will get you out of your seat.
I didn't feel like I was going to fall out. The only ride I have been on where you lift out of your seat going upside down is Ring Of Fire but your in a locked cage so can really go anywhere. The even have padding on the roof of the train.
